Manojlovich was a male ensign in Starfleet, who served as assistant chief of security aboard the USS Lexington in 2348. He was killed that year on Altair VI, when an-Jirok forces launched a coup. His death inspired a great deal of guilt in his suprerior, chief of security Lieutenant Declan Keogh, who was to have led the security contingent to the planet, but reassigned Manojlovich due to being hung over. (ST novel: The Brave and the Bold)
